About the Author
Simon Buckingham founded Mobile Lifestreams Limited in January 1999 with a view to adding value to value-added services and to evangelize the development and deployment of non-voice mobile services to the mobile communications industry.
Simon has extensive knowledge and experience of this industry gained from his six years of working for mobile operator giant, Vodafone, in areas of the company such as E-Plus in Germany, value added services, quality, marketing, packet radio, personnel and the Vodafone Business Partners Programme, which Simon setup and managed in his final 18 months. This programme managed the relations between the network and independent companies such as software developers and terminal manufacturers.
Following his time with Vodafone, Simon took on the role of Global SMS Manager for Brightpoint, the world's largest distributor of mobile phones. He traveled the world investigating the business case for the Short Messaging Service (SMS) and delivering such services to network operators. In October 1998, he published Data on SMS which was such a huge success that it instigated the decision to form Mobile Lifestreams.
Simon is a prolific author of books about a wide range of mobile data related topics such as SMS, WAP, GPRS and 3G. He is an acknowledged conference speaker on these and other topics and has consulted for a wide range of companies globally including Palm, NTT DoCoMo and GTE Wireless. He has been quoted in most major publications including the Financial Times, Wall Street Journal, The Economist, Marketing, Mobile Communications International as well as publications in India, South Africa, Slovakia, Norway and many more.
